Senate. Comm. on Petition of W. Vans. Report, 1834
SEE ALSO 52521 Senate No. 62 A Committee charged to consider the endless case of Mr. Vans said the property of John Codman had long since been
vested in his heirs and the Legislature could offer no remedy. On march 5, 1834, the Committee was asked for its reasons. it pointed out case law that
argued against changing the statute of limitations for one person and referred to legislative reports that ruled against Vans, as well. (Digitized
from a microfilm copy of title originally held by the Massachusetts State Library).
Title:   The committee to whom was referred the petition of William Vans, and the several memorials accompanying it, after hearing the said Vans, by his counsel, have considered the same, and report ...
